Netzwerk-Add-Ons für EKS Amazon-Cluster verwalten - Amazon EKS

Hilf mit, diese Seite zu verbessern

Möchten Sie zu diesem Benutzerhandbuch beitragen? Scrollen Sie zum Ende dieser Seite und wählen Sie Diese Seite bearbeiten am aus GitHub. Ihre Beiträge werden dazu beitragen, unser Benutzerhandbuch für alle zu verbessern.

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Netzwerk-Add-Ons für EKS Amazon-Cluster verwalten

Für Ihren EKS Amazon-Cluster sind mehrere Netzwerk-Add-Ons verfügbar.

Integrierte Add-Ons

Anmerkung

Wenn Sie Cluster auf irgendeine Weise erstellen, außer mithilfe der Konsole, enthält jeder Cluster die selbstverwalteten Versionen der integrierten Add-Ons. Die selbstverwalteten Versionen können nicht über AWS Management Console AWS Command Line Interface, oder SDKs verwaltet werden. Sie verwalten die Konfiguration und Upgrades von selbstverwalteten Add-Ons.

Wir empfehlen, den EKS Amazon-Typ des Add-ons zu Ihrem Cluster hinzuzufügen, anstatt den selbstverwalteten Typ des Add-ons zu verwenden. Wenn Sie Cluster in der Konsole erstellen, wird der EKS Amazon-Typ dieser Add-Ons installiert.

Amazon VPC CNI plugin for Kubernetes

Dieses CNI Add-on erstellt elastische Netzwerkschnittstellen und verbindet sie mit Ihren EC2 Amazon-Knoten. Das Add-on weist jedem Dienst auch eine private IPv6 Adresse IPv4 oder Adresse von Ihrem VPC zu. Pod Dieses Add-on ist standardmäßig auf Ihrem Cluster installiert. Weitere Informationen finden Sie unter IPsDem Pods Amazon zuordnen VPC CNI.

CoreDNS

CoreDNSist ein flexibler, erweiterbarer DNS Server, der als Cluster dienen kann. Kubernetes DNS CoreDNSbietet die Namensauflösung für alle Mitglieder Pods des Clusters. Dieses Add-on ist standardmäßig auf Ihrem Cluster installiert. Weitere Informationen finden Sie unter Core DNS für DNS in EKS Amazon-Clustern verwalten.

kube-proxy

Dieses Add-on verwaltet die Netzwerkregeln auf Ihren EC2 Amazon-Knoten und ermöglicht die Netzwerkkommunikation mit IhrenPods. Dieses Add-on ist standardmäßig auf Ihrem Cluster installiert. Weitere Informationen finden Sie unter kube-proxyIn EKS Amazon-Clustern verwalten.

Optionale AWS Netzwerk-Add-Ons

AWS Load Balancer Controller

Wenn Sie Kubernetes Dienstobjekte dieses Typs bereitstellenloadbalancer, erstellt der Controller AWS Network Load Balancer. Wenn Sie Kubernetes Eingangsobjekte erstellen, erstellt der Controller AWS Application Load Balancer. Wir empfehlen, diesen Controller für die Bereitstellung von Network Load Balancern zu verwenden, anstatt den in Kubernetes integrierten Legacy-Cloud-Provider-Controller zu verwenden. Weitere Informationen finden Sie in der Dokumentation zu AWS Load Balancer Controller.

AWS Gateway-Controller API

Mit diesem Controller können Sie Dienste über mehrere Kubernetes Cluster mithilfe des KubernetesGateways verbindenAPI. Der Controller verbindet Kubernetes Dienste, die auf EC2 Amazon-Instances, Containern und serverlosen Funktionen ausgeführt werden, mithilfe des Amazon VPC Lattice-Dienstes. Weitere Informationen finden Sie in der AWS Gateway API Controller-Dokumentation.

Weitere Informationen zu Add-ons finden Sie unter EKSAmazon-Add-Ons.